"Where is my mom? Do you think one day she will come to take me home?" a boy asked Arkady during his time there.
"That moment, tears rolled down my eyes," the photographer said. "But I told him: 'We are your family and your friends. We are here for you.'"During Akady's journey, he spent time teaching the children how to use his camera, how to paint, and and worked on a documentary over the children as well as fleeing Yazidi girls.
